What is 60/46 Divided By 3/7

Answer: 6046÷37\frac{60}{46}\div\frac{3}{7} = 7023\frac{70}{23}

Solving 6046÷37\frac{60}{46}\div\frac{3}{7}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

6046÷37=6046×73\frac{60}{46} \div \frac{3}{7} = \frac{60}{46} \times \frac{7}{3}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 60×7=42060 \times 7 = 420
  • Multiply the Denominators: 46×3=13846 \times 3 = 138
  • Form the New Fraction: 6046×37=420138\frac{60}{46} \times \frac{3}{7} = \frac{420}{138}

Let's Simplify 420138\frac{420}{138}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 420420 and 138138. The GCD of 420420 and 138138 is 66.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:420÷6138÷6=7023\frac{420 \div 6}{138 \div 6} = \frac{70}{23}

Answer 6046÷37=7023\frac{60}{46}\div\frac{3}{7} = \frac{70}{23}
